What problem does it solve?

Ensures software delivers actual value, not just functionality or scalability, through critical product analysis and feature audits.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Critical Product Analysis: Validate if software meets real user needs, identify redundancies, and assess the real value of features.
  • Feature Audits: Audits features for potential issues like redundancy, confusion, and lack of clear value proposition.
  • Use Case: Before investing more time into a feature, use this skill to check its actual value, avoid creating features that won't be used, and prioritize features based on real impact.
